What role does mathematics training play in improving a person that other training can't replace?
Mathematics training plays an irreplaceable role in improving one's logical thinking ability, problem-solving ability, mathematics literacy and innovation ability. The following is a section.

First of all, mathematics is a subject of exploring laws and proving, which requires imagination and abstract thinking. These attributes are different from the cognitive skills required by other disciplines, so only through mathematical training can one improve one's logical thinking ability. This includes reasoning by understanding and using mathematical symbols, cultivating judgment and reasoning ability by solving mathematical problems, and cultivating critical and innovative thinking by solving practical problems and establishing models.

Secondly, mathematical training can greatly improve a person's problem-solving ability. There are many abstract and difficult problems to be solved in mathematics. Solving these problems requires a series of analysis, reasoning and calculation steps. This problem-solving method inspires us to explore the principle behind the problem and think about how to solve the problem in different ways. This way of thinking can also be applied to other fields and daily life to improve the ability to solve problems.

Thirdly, mathematics training is also extremely important for improving personal mathematics literacy. Mathematics is a widely used technical field, and more and more fields depend on mathematical techniques and methods, such as natural science, social science, finance and business.

Mathematical literacy is not only to skillfully use basic mathematical operations or deductive theorems, but also requires individuals to understand the meaning and relationship of related concepts, understand their scope of application, and master the application skills in practical problems. Through mathematics training, we can improve our practical ability of applying mathematics in various fields.

Finally, mathematics training also has a significant impact on cultivating individual innovation ability. Mathematics is a subject to explore the unknown. Since ancient times, scholars have been discovering new things and theories in the field of mathematics.

These discoveries and explorations will also produce many enlightening ideas and ideas, which can provide rich materials for innovation. Moreover, mathematical innovation is not only theoretical innovation, but also involves digital and information processing, intelligent calculation and so on, so mathematical training is also helpful to cultivate individuals' innovative ability in this respect.

In a word, mathematics training is a unique and powerful training method, which helps to improve the individual's logical thinking ability, problem-solving ability, mathematics literacy and innovation ability, and can effectively improve the individual's skill level and future growth ability.
